Eco-Friendly Shopping: Second-Hand and Zero Waste

In today’s world, with increasing environmental awareness, individuals are reshaping their habits for a more sustainable lifestyle. Eco-friendly shopping is not only about using resources more efficiently but also about taking responsibility for leaving a livable planet to future generations. At the heart of this understanding lie second-hand shopping and zero-waste practices.

 Environmental Benefits of Second-Hand Shopping

 Conservation of Natural Resources

Producing new products requires the intensive use of energy, water, and other natural resources. Opting for second-hand items significantly reduces the consumption of these resources, making a substantial contribution to the environment.

 Reducing Waste

Tons of products are thrown away every year, threatening both the environment and ecosystems. Second-hand shopping enables unused items to be repurposed, reducing the amount of waste sent to landfills.

 Lowering Carbon Footprint

The production, logistics, and sale of new products result in a high carbon emission output. Second-hand goods eliminate the environmental impact of these processes, helping to reduce carbon footprints.

 Popular Second-Hand Items

  • Clothing and Accessories: Vintage fashion allows you to contribute to nature while reflecting your personal style uniquely.
  • Furniture: Restored old furniture offers unique and durable decoration options.
  • Electronics: Second-hand electronics stand out as eco-friendly and economical alternatives.

 What is the Zero Waste Philosophy?

Zero waste is a sustainable approach aimed at producing as little waste as possible throughout a product's lifecycle. When combined with second-hand shopping, this approach minimizes waste production and promotes the reuse cycle.

 Tips for Zero Waste Shopping

  • Bring Your Own Bag
    Carry reusable shopping bags with you to avoid using plastic bags.
  • Choose Local and Unpackaged Products
    Shop from zero-waste stores or markets to prevent packaging waste.
  • Use Glass and Metal
    Reduce your environmental impact by choosing glass bottles, metal storage containers, or straws instead of single-use plastics.
  • Buy Only What You Need
    Control your consumption to avoid unnecessary waste. Planned shopping protects both your budget and the environment.

 Second-Hand and Zero Waste: Stronger Together

Second-hand shopping and the zero-waste philosophy form two essential pillars of sustainable living. While unused products are repurposed, the consumption of new items is reduced, alleviating pressure on the environment.
